mdwright-math
Markdown math-region recognition for mdwright: delimiter policy, region scanning, and balance diagnostics for TeX-style math embedded in Markdown.
CommonMark does not understand math. Inside \[ … \], \( … \), $$ … $$, $ … $, or
\begin{env} … \end{env}, pulldown tokenises bytes as plain prose, so _ becomes
emphasis, [ becomes a link candidate, and * becomes an emphasis-delimiter candidate. Without an overlay
the formatter's round-trip drifts. This crate is that overlay: scan::scan_math_regions
consumes Markdown source plus the IR's inline and block atoms and produces typed
MathRegion values plus the math/unbalanced-delim, math/unbalanced-env, and
math/unbalanced-braces diagnostics.
Math-body grammar (TeX commands, Unicode layout, source translation) is delegated to the
mdwright-latex crate. Pulldown invocation and document facts are owned by
mdwright-document.
